Output 0e76c518a632b5d84051324c55402ac297e27d6d904f680b69bac88894306ec2:35

value
91829
script pubkey
OP_0 OP_PUSHBYTES_20 81b1ca1db13e3a5daa69f5c548d29966f4def11e
address
bc1qsxcu58d38ca9m2nf7hz5355evm6daug7hsfcn4
transaction
0e76c518a632b5d84051324c55402ac297e27d6d904f680b69bac88894306ec2
confirmations
155047
spent
true